Twain’s Owners Announce New Brewer

Atlanta only had four brewpub brewers when October came to an end. At the time I am typing this, two of those have been replaced. Jordan Fleetwood, Twain’s (211 Trinity Pl, Decatur, 404.373.0063) brewer since the Decatur bar turned brewpub several years ago, has now been replaced by David Stein, a young brewer who apprenticed at BrewDog in Scotland. Twain’s: Choco-nut, a bold cask-conditioned brown ale

Like wine, some beers are drinking brews while others are best enjoyed with nosh. Brown ales rank near the top of all beer styles when pairing with food. Though many are mild and only hold their own against nuts and cheeses, more robust renditions can stand up to red meat, and some hoppier versions may even cut through spicy stews.
